Shah Rukh Khan's Jawan has turned out to be a massive blockbuster at the box office. The pan-India massy actioner has been garnering praises not only from fans but also from celebs across the country. Recently we saw Riteish Deshmukh, Soni Razdan, Mahesh Babu, Anupam Kher, Akshay Kumar, SS Rajamouli and others praising the film. And now SRK's close friend and talented filmmaker Karan Johar joined the bandwagon.
A few minutes back, he shared a note on his Instagram praising the film and its cast and crew for delivering this cinematic experience. Posting the official poster of Jawan, which has Shah Rukh's multiple looks, Karan Johar wrote, "OMFG!!!!! I am late to this party!!!! But what a party this is!!!! @atlee47 hits it out of the stadium… it’s the kind of adrenalin rush film with big emotion that Indian cinema embodies and this film perfects!!!! Was blown away by the cinematic audacity of each frame!!!! How good was everyone !!! @sanyamalhotra_ @pillumani so so good! The entire ensemble! The gorgeous and fabulous @nayanthara @actorvijaysethupathi is so brilliant! Was mesmerised by @deepikapadukone she bought so much gravitas to her part and owned it like a bonafide veteran!!!! DP❤️❤️❤️❤️ and what do I say about Bhai @iamsrk … he is not just an irreplaceable force of nature but represents mega stardom in a way that only he can!!!!! He’s the emperor and we bow down in admiration … if you haven’t seen #jawan then you don’t know what you’re missing out on!!!! @redchilliesent @_gauravverma @poojadadlani02 my favourite producer @gaurikhan …. Congratulations !!! Juggernaut Alert!"
Jawan, which has been on a rampage at the box office, has turned out to be one of the biggest Bollywood grossers of all time. The film marks the Hindi directorial debut of Kollywood filmmaker Atlee.
